Objective The objective of this study was to assess the efficacy of heparin-bonded catheters for preventing thrombosis in infants aged less than 1 year with congenital heart disease.
p Value <0.001
OR 6.3
Conclusion Infants with congenital heart disease are at significant risk of both silent and clinically identified thrombosis. There seems to be no advantage in using heparin-bonded catheters in infants less than 1 year of age.
